What comes to mind when you think of “lifelong learning”? Oh, wait. Did you just roll your eyes and give a defeated sigh? Girl, we know the feeling.

Some of your feelings might be valid but here are some thoughts you might have that are definitely wrong.

Here are some of the lies you probably tell yourself all year round which eventually hinders your growth:

I have a degree. What am I still learning?

Big mistake, sister. When did you graduate? 2, 5, 10 years ago? The world is changing fast and we need to evolve.

 Standing in one spot only means that others are going to overtake you and take opportunities that should’ve been yours.

Look at Nokia. How long did it take for them to lose their position as Number 1 phone maker? To be a successful Motherland Mogul, you need to keep learning the new trends in your industry.

I am an expert in my field

It’s very easy for us to settle for what we think we know is best. But does learning ever stop? If you have plans to branch out and innovate your brand, you need to prepare yourself!

Are there other things you learn from other industries that may be linked to yours?

There is so much more to learn about your passions, hobbies, and interests. Ask yourself questions such as ‘how badass is my excel skills’? When was the last time I gave a presentation that was wowed my audience?

Take the time to improve and build on what you already have and what you need to make yourself better.

I don’t have money for courses.

In this day and age, you don’t have to spend a lot of money to learn! With a stable internet connection and time, you can access so many free resources online.

From Coursera, Udemy, Skillshare, YouTube and the many blogs and articles out there; the options are endless.

But once you choose to make this investment, you start the journey towards a successful and educated life.

I don’t have time to learn.

Let’s rephrase that as “I don’t make out time for learning new things because it’s not a priority.” Doesn’t sound nice, does it?

Well, it’s true. We all make time for things that we consider priorities. Catching up on social media, binging on Netflix, attending owambe parties. But if we think about it, we spend many hours every week on things that aren’t really adding to our bottom line.

If you’re one of those superwomen who resists all such temptations and still can’t find the time to learn, what about the time you spend in traffic? With the developments of education and technology, you can learn anywhere and everywhere!

So, don’t make excuses for wanting to learn. If you believe in investing in yourself, then you will make the time to learn more.

I’m too old to learn

Lol! Did you know the oldest person to graduate college was 95 years old? We’re never too old to learn. Even if you have started a family and gotten 7 children, it’s never too late! It’s all about prioritizing. We can always learn new tricks!

You’ve probably run out of excuses now. But don’t let this daunt you. The trick is to start small. Pick one skill and set yourself a target of one hour a week to develop it. If you don’t know where to start, Google resources and create a learning calendar.  

Once you set milestones and give yourself small treats every now and then, you’ll be surprised by what you learn in a few months.
